Midway extended their losing streak to seven on Monday, dropping them down to 1-16. They came up short against the Oak Ridge Wildcats, falling 18-1.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Wildcats this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 13-1 last Tuesday.
Midway sa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Lorelai Langley,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with one double and one RBI. That double was Langley's first of the season.
As for Oak Ridge, they are on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six games. That's provided a nice bump to their 9-14-1 record this season. Their hitters st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most runs they've scored all season.
On Oak Ridge's side, they got a massive performance out of Anslee Douglas, who went 3-for-4 with four RBI, two runs, and two doubles. Those four RBI gave Douglas a new career-high. Bay Hensley was another key player, going a perfect 3-for-3 with three runs, two doubles, and two RBI.
Midway did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next matchup, a 16-5 win against Rockwood on the 21st. As for Oak Ridge, they also w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next contest, a 3-2 defeat against First Baptist Academy on the 21st.
